Usage examples of "fare una domanda" in Italian with translation to English

<>
Alzò la mano per fare una domanda. She raised her hand to ask a question.
Takeshi ha alzato la mano per fare una domanda. Takeshi raised his hand to ask a question.
Può essere una domanda sciocca, ma qual è più forte, una tigre o un leone? This may be a silly question, but which is stronger - a tiger or a lion?
